Walmart is now offering the limited-edition Mario & Luigi: Dream Team 3DS XL bundle for $149.99, $50 off its original price.
The bundle first arrived in the U.S. in December, when it retailed for $200. It includes a silver 3DS XL system with a gold outline of the plumber brothers printed on the front and a 4GB SD card with Mario & Luigi: Dream Team pre-installed.
Regular blue and red 3DS XL systems retail for $199.99, meaning buyers can score a limited-edition system and recent game for $50 less than a standard system by itself.
In our Mario & Luigi: Dream Team review, we found that it "excels at throwing up a constant barrage of funny, thrilling and game-altering surprises, all of which gel together with the kind of finesse and confidence that Nintendo fans have come to demand."
A variety of other limited-edition options, including a Legend of Zelda: A Link Between Worlds 3DS XL bundle and Pokemon X & Y themed systems, have provided several tempting deals for prospective portable gamers within the past few months.
